Choose either photosynthesis or respiration and write a lesson plan or a concept map for the topic. Your lesson plan should be suited for a college level. The purpose in writing a lesson plan or creating a concept map for any topic is to assist you in truly understanding the concepts covered by putting them in your own words. A concept map is a diagram showing the relationships among concepts. They are graphical tools for organizing and representing knowledge.
